Subcultures are a minority part of the majority culture. Although they have committed to the wider culture, they have distinct norms and values which distinguish them as different.

Subcultures can exist in school; Jackson found anti-school subcultures amongst working class teenage peer groups. In her study she showed ‘lads and ladettes’ controlling each other’s behavior by encouraging rebellion and cheekiness by rewarding it with popularity.

There are Many subcultures in contemporary UK; some are based on leisure pursuits such as skaters or football fans, some are eco subculture groups and some are religious subculture groups such as scientologists.
